摘要:
在Linux中,新建的线程并不是在原先的进程中,而是系统通过一个系统调用clone()。该系统copy了一个和原先进程完全一样的进程,并在这个进程中执行线程函数。不过这个copy过程和fork不一样。 copy后的进程和原先的进程共享了所有的变量,运行环境。这样,原先进程中的变量变动在copy后的进 阅读全文
posted @ 2017-07-03 16:03
小 楼 一 夜 听 春 雨
阅读(17818)
评论(0)
推荐(1)
摘要:
linux支持的哪些操作是具有原子特性的?知道这些东西是理解和设计无锁化编程算法的基础。 下面的东西整理自网络。先感谢大家的分享! __sync_fetch_and_add系列的命令,发现这个系列命令讲的最好的一篇文章,英文好的同学可以直接去看原文。Multithreaded simple data 阅读全文
posted @ 2017-07-03 15:17
小 楼 一 夜 听 春 雨
阅读(8244)
评论(0)
推荐(0)

浙公网安备 33010602011771号